基于米客SSD2828的MIPI 驱动板LCD初始化例程

最近很多客户购买RGB转MIPI驱动板后成功点亮了自己的屏幕,看到提供的驱动方案让客户有成果非常高兴。当然也有部分没有点亮,主要原因是在与LCD初始化部分不知道怎么写。

其实你需要花点时间研究SSD2828芯片资料和我们提供的使用指南。

LCD初始化就是使SSD2828芯片在LP模式通过MIPI DSI0 lane 进行配置LCD初始化数据配置。

提供的代码也提供了封装函数。

主要是以下函数
GP_COMMAD_PA(num);
SPI_WriteData(dat);

其中GP_COMMAD_PA(num)的num代表后面你要发的数据个数

SPI_WriteData(dat);dat 后面就是发的数据,dat是unsigned char

例如通过DSI0 发3个数据0x55,0xFF,0x0F

GP_COMMAD_PA(3);
SPI_WriteData(0x55);SPI_WriteData(0xFF);SPI_WriteData(0x0F);

例如通过DSI0 发1个数据0x11

GP_COMMAD_PA(1);
SPI_WriteData(0x11);

更多请关注 www.weilaizhijia.com.cn

发表评论

电子邮件地址不会被公开。 必填项已用*标注